What Can Weather Forecasters Teach Us About Executive Presence?
Despite being the butt of endless jokes, the best weather forecasters quietly demonstrate executive presence every day in how they:1) are willing to make predictions—and be wrong2) translate mountains of data into clear, actionable guidance3) take the most default of all default conversation topics (“So… how ’bout the weather?”) and actually engage stakeholdersBecause weather is constant—something we check, talk about, and experience every day—these leadership lessons are hard to ignore once you notice them.Check out the Season 7 kickoff of The Energy Detox, recorded during the January 2026 winter storm that impacted much of the United States.

90 Billion Reasons You Should Start an Energy Leadership ‘Shop Class’
Mike Rowe proposed that "somebody somewhere carves out just a little sliver" from the $90B of announced investments "and allocates it for better storytelling" so that kids, parents, and guidance counselors can SEE the prosperity that flows from learning and using in-demand skills.While the insights and solutions Mike shared during yesterday's Energy & Innovation Summit were focused on BIG PICTURE, WIDE-RANGING workforce challenges, his comments equally apply to leaders like you who unwittingly miss opportunities to carve out "just a little sliver" of time to better showcase the work you and your team do and, in turn, significantly boost engagement and understanding among your INTERNAL stakeholders.As discussed in Episode 116 of The Energy Detox (appropriately recorded amidst the noise of hard-working construction workers performing "dirty jobs" outside of PPG Paints Arena), the reason that you—and many of the leaders who took part in the CMU summit—miss those opportunities is because you're busy taking the ACTIONS and busy generating RESULTS that are expected of you.However, sometimes actions do NOT speak louder than words; and sometimes results do NOT speak for themselves.So, take a moment to ask yourself:"How can I use the idea of a 'shop class' to more effectively expose internal stakeholders to the work that my team and I do?"
